Prometheus热加载如何处理监控数据隐私问题?
在当今数字化时代,随着企业对监控数据的依赖程度日益加深,如何处理监控数据隐私问题成为了一个亟待解决的问题。Prometheus作为一款开源监控工具,在处理监控数据时,其热加载功能尤为重要。本文将深入探讨Prometheus热加载如何处理监控数据隐私问题。
一、Prometheus热加载简介
Prometheus热加载(Hot Reloading)是指在不停止Prometheus服务的情况下,实时加载新的配置文件。这一功能使得Prometheus能够快速响应业务需求的变化,提高监控系统的灵活性。然而,在享受热加载带来的便利的同时,如何确保监控数据的隐私安全,成为了一个不容忽视的问题。
二、监控数据隐私问题
监控数据中可能包含企业内部敏感信息,如用户行为数据、业务数据等。若这些数据泄露,将对企业造成严重的损失。以下是常见的监控数据隐私问题:
- 数据泄露:监控数据可能被非法获取,导致企业机密泄露。
- 数据滥用:监控数据可能被用于非法目的,如商业间谍活动。
- 数据追踪:监控数据可能被用于追踪用户行为,侵犯用户隐私。
三、Prometheus热加载如何处理监控数据隐私问题
数据加密:Prometheus支持数据加密功能,可以对监控数据进行加密存储和传输。在热加载过程中,加密算法会自动应用于新加载的配置文件,确保数据安全。
访问控制:Prometheus提供访问控制机制,可限制对监控数据的访问权限。通过设置用户角色和权限,确保只有授权人员才能访问敏感数据。
数据脱敏:在热加载过程中,可以对敏感数据进行脱敏处理,如将用户名、密码等替换为随机字符串。这样可以降低数据泄露的风险。
审计日志:Prometheus支持审计日志功能,记录用户对监控数据的访问和操作。通过审计日志,可以及时发现异常行为,防止数据泄露。
安全配置:在Prometheus配置文件中,可以设置安全相关的参数,如禁用不安全的HTTP方法、限制HTTP请求频率等。这些措施有助于提高监控系统的安全性。
四、案例分析
某企业采用Prometheus进行监控,其业务数据包含用户行为数据、交易数据等敏感信息。为处理监控数据隐私问题,企业采取了以下措施:
- 对监控数据进行加密存储和传输。
- 设置访问控制,限制对敏感数据的访问权限。
- 对敏感数据进行脱敏处理。
- 开启审计日志功能,记录用户对监控数据的访问和操作。
通过以上措施,企业在享受Prometheus热加载带来的便利的同时,有效保障了监控数据的隐私安全。
五、总结
Prometheus热加载在处理监控数据隐私问题时,采取了一系列措施,如数据加密、访问控制、数据脱敏等。这些措施有助于提高监控系统的安全性,降低数据泄露风险。企业在使用Prometheus进行监控时,应充分考虑数据隐私问题,并采取相应措施保障数据安全。
猜你喜欢:可观测性平台